Job Description
Duties:
Written Curriculum:
- Creates and plans trans-disciplinary units of inquiry from which lessons are taught and supports this with written planning.
- Develops and teaches a course of study according to the school’s grade-level scope and sequence.
- Plans lessons that assist primarily English as an Additional Language (EAL) students.
- Tailors lessons for several levels of academic ability within the same classroom, bearing in mind different learning styles and prior experiences.
- Incorporates the Essential Elements of the International Baccalaureate Primary Years Program (IB – PYP) into inquiry-based, constructivist learning experiences within the classroom.
- Collaborates with other teachers in planning on a regular basis.
Taught Curriculum:
- Presents lessons by way of differentiated instruction methods (including ICT) that support primarily ESL students.
- Examines, re-examines and reflects upon teaching practices in order to provide the best possible opportunities to explore the trans-disciplinary units of inquiry across the curriculum and beyond.
- Provides a stimulating learning atmosphere within the classroom.
- Models for students the character attributes of the IB Learner Profile.
- Uses excellent written and oral English skills when communicating.
- Observes the classroom expectations handbook, involving care and within maintenance of the classroom.
Assessed curriculum:
- Monitors, assists, corrects and assesses student results by preparing assessments according to IB assessment strategies and tools.
- Observes the Essential Agreements on assessment created by teachers and set within the Assessment, Recording and Reporting Handbook.
- Maintains student portfolios and assessment records according to assessment guidelines and under the time constraints required.
Professional Duties:
- Maintains order in the classroom and provides a safe, secure and healthy educational environment by establishing, following and enforcing standards and procedures, complying with all legal regulations.
- Informs parents by maintaining records of academic performance, attendance and social acclimation, reporting on all elements of student development at parent-teacher meetings, both regularly scheduled and as-needed.
- Complies with set IEP guidelines and contributes professional feedback at all IEP meetings.
- Maintains strict confidentiality in regard to students and their records.
- Provides student support services by monitoring play areas, restrooms and dining hall facilities, maintaining after-school club(s) if requested and leading students on field trips.
- Attends scheduled staff/committee meetings.
- Contributes professional expertise in the development and writing of collaborative school policies and procedures.
- Completes all required annual IB professional development workshops/classes/ seminars.
- Provides for the safety of school-bought resources.
- Represents the school within the broader community with professional conduct that supports the mission of the school.
- Enhances the school’s reputation by accepting requests and exploring opportunities to add value to job accomplishment.
